These two posts are cut out as at 56, see Figure 6.
The member A, of the fastening means is mounted in the tread end of the heel I4, Within a recess 58 therein, which recess is of a depth which is greater than the thickness of the member A. This construction provides a seat or thelike 60, upon the tread .end of theheel, which seat lies in a plane beyond the outer face of the member A of the fastening means, as illustrated by the space 62, in Figure 5.
The member B, of the fastening means is carried by the lift member I6, and to secure the same tothe lift member, I provide on the outer f edge of the plate-like member 52, a plurality of very closely adjacent prongs 64. Each of these prongs is provided on its outer end with a piercing point 66, and where the prongs join ,the
main body portion of the plate, each is provided with oppositely curved portions which provide oppositely disposed locking shoulders 68, upon the side edges of each prong. In attaching the illustratedl in Figure 3.
plate 52, to the lift I6, the prongs 64 are bent at an angle to the body portionrof the plate, as illustrated in Figure 6, in such a manner that when pressure is applied to the plate 52, the
prongs; 64, and their locking shoulders 68, will be embedded in the material ofthe lift I6, which is preferably leather. The locking shoulders 6B serve rto anchor the prongs in the'material of the lift, and by providing a large numb-er of prongs, closely associated With one another, the plate is notonly rmlysecured 'to the lift I6, but the plate is held in close contact throughout itsdeiining edge with the face of the lift I6. Still another advantage resulting from this construction resides in the fact that by using the prongs in large numbers together with theV locking shoulders, I am enabled to make the prongs comparatively short or atV least short enough that they do not p-ass entirely through the heel In placing the lift upon the heel, the latch member 30 is moved toits extended position as The posts 54 of the member l?,` are then positioned in the openings 46, after which the latch member is moved to its innermost position whereupon the side edges of the latch member pass intothe cut out portions 55, of the Vposts 54, and thereby prevent Withdrawal of the posts 54, from the openings 46, and thus locking the interengaging members A and B together.` 'I'he latch member 30 has a projecting lug or member 10, which engages in an opening 'I2 in the filler plate 24, when the latch plate is'in its innermost position, and this means serves to. retain the latch plate in its holding position.
Also, means is provided lto prevent relative.
sliding or rotary movement ofthe lift'and heel, and this means preferably consists of a portion 16, of the turned over portion 40, of the flange 22, whichportion is left standing up and is inVv such a position that it passes through the ycut out portion 18, of theplate 52, and into biting engagement with the lift I6, thus preventing relative movement between the lift and the heel.
When it is desired to remove the lift from the heel, it is only necessary to insert a tool or similar article behind the member 34, of the latch plate 30, and exert a slight outward pressure thereon. This Will move thek latch plate to its extended position, whereupon the notches 50, will coincide with the notches 48, and the posts will be free to pass from they openings C.
The plate 52, is of a greater transverse dimension than is the recess in the heel in which the member A, is positioned, and thus when the lift is in position upon the heel, the plate 52, engages and bears upon the seat 60, which defines said recess, and since, as before stated, this plate is of sti or rigidvmaterial, the pressure occasioned by the weight of the` person wearingv the shoe, `is transmitted directly to the heel by the plate 52,
and the fastening means is relieved of all strain incidental to the wearing of the device.
From the foregoing, it will begapparent thaty preferred embodiment, in which it has been applied to the lift ofthe heel of a ladys'shoe. It is to be understood, however, that it may also be incorporated in lifts of larger sizes, such as are employed in connection with mens shoes or it may also be employed asa means for attaching a heel to a shoe instead of attaching a lift to a heel.
Having thus described the invention, what is` claimed, is: k
A detachable lift for shoe heels comprising in combination, a shoe heel, a lift therefor, and a two-part fastening means for said lift, one part of said fastening means being carried by the shoe heel and including a housing, a tongue projecting from said housing, the` other part of said two-part fastening Vmeans being carried by the lift and including a rigidplate having a portion thereof removed to permit of the afore-mentioned projecting tongue of the housing of the other part of the fastening means to engage the lift to prevent turning or sliding movement thereof relative to the shoe heel, studs on the plate penetrating the housing, a locking plate slidably mounted in the housing and having edgewise locking engageek ment with the studs and cooperating means carried by the plate and an element within the housing for securing the plate against accidental sliding movement.
